社区
C语言
帖子详情
设计算法判断无向图G是否是连通的,若连通则返回true,否则返回false。
jhqjhq
2003-05-22 09:53:40
设计算法判断无向图G是否是连通的,若连通则返回true,否则返回false。
可以使用以下几个函数调用:
firstadj(G,v)—返回图G中顶点v的第一个邻接点,若不存在返回0
nextadj(G,v,w)—返回图G中顶点v的邻接点中处于w之后的邻接点,若不存在返回0
nodes(G)—返回图G中的顶点数
怎么做呢?
...全文
1092
4
打赏
收藏
设计算法判断无向图G是否是连通的,若连通则返回true,否则返回false。
设计算法判断无向图G是否是连通的,若连通则返回true,否则返回false。 可以使用以下几个函数调用: firstadj(G,v)—返回图G中顶点v的第一个邻接点,若不存在返回0 nextadj(G,v,w)—返回图G中顶点v的邻接点中处于w之后的邻接点,若不存在返回0 nodes(G)—返回图G中的顶点数 怎么做呢?
复制链接
扫一扫
分享
转发到动态
举报
写回复
配置赞助广告
用AI写文章
4 条
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
jhqjhq
2003-05-24
打赏
举报
回复
邻接矩阵
zzpdhr
2003-05-24
打赏
举报
回复
任取一点v,用深度优先搜索遍历它能够达到的所有结点,
然后比较一下能够达到的所有结点数是否等于nodes(G)
renfeiyang
2003-05-24
打赏
举报
回复
提示一个思路:用邻接矩阵存储图,然后,如果对于边(i,j)存在,则删除顶点i后,保存j,不会影响图的连通性,(同样思路可以用于求图是否存在环)
lbaby
2003-05-22
打赏
举报
回复
怎么存储的啊
第4章 第4节 图的
连通
性问题(C++版)-2020.03.21.pdf
有向图中的
连通
性涉及到了两个顶点之间是否有方向性的路径存在,而
无向图
则主要关注顶点之间是否存在无向的路径。在实际应用中,比如社交网络分析、网络路由、电路
设计
等领域,图的
连通
性问题具有广泛的应用。 一、...
有向图的欧拉回路
在有向图中,边的方向决定了路径的走向,因此
判断
有向图是否存在欧拉回路比
无向图
更为复杂。这里介绍两种方法:桥的检测和Fleury
算法
。 首先,我们需要理解桥的概念。在有向图中,如果删除一条边后,导致原本
连通
的...
离散数学实验四:图的随机生成及欧拉(回)路的确定.doc
在这个实验中,学生被要求
设计
一个程序,该程序能根据输入的顶点数`n`(1到20之间的一个整数)生成一个
无向图
,并
判断
这个图是否具有欧拉路径或欧拉回路。欧拉路径是指从图中任意一点出发,沿着边恰好经过每一条边一...
warshell.zip_matlab例程_matlab_
对于
无向图
,邻接矩阵是对称的;对于有向图,可能不是。如果两个顶点间有边,则矩阵中的对应元素为非零值,通常设置为1。 接下来,我们解释
算法
的步骤: 1. 初始化:构建邻接矩阵A,其大小为顶点数n乘以n。A[i][j]...
判断
无向图
G是否
连通
。若
连通
返回
1,否则
返回
0
判断
无向图
G是否
连通
。 若
连通
返回
1,否则
返回
0 CODE: /*
判断
无向图
G是否
连通
。 若
连通
返回
1,否则
返回
0 */ #define N 1 >> 8 //代替无穷大(默认 邻接矩阵) #define size 6 #include <stdio.h>...
C语言
70,037
社区成员
243,247
社区内容
发帖
与我相关
我的任务
C语言
C语言相关问题讨论
复制链接
扫一扫
分享
社区描述
C语言相关问题讨论
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
暂无公告
试试用AI创作助手写篇文章吧
+ 用AI写文章